This September, I am taking part in the Great Cycle Challenge to fight kids' cancer!

Why? Because right now, cancer is the biggest killer of children from disease in the United States. Over 15,700 children are diagnosed every year, and sadly, 38 children die of cancer every week.

Kids should be living life, not fighting for it.

So I am raising funds through my challenge to help these kids and support Children's Cancer Research Fund to allow them to continue their work to develop lifesaving treatments and find a cure for childhood cancer.

    1 Sep 2026

    Signed up the first day of registration. I was feeling very weak at the time but I thought I could build my strength over the summer. I was wrong, my leukemia kept getting worse and I became weaker. My oncologist told me I needed to start treatment but first I had to have a lot of testing to make sure I could handle the treatment.

    I had ct scans, pet scans, an MRI of my heart, a bone marrow biopsy. Now I’m waiting on the treatment center to tell me I’m ready to go.

    This is a different kind of treatment than I had in 2021 so I don’t know what to expect. I set my goals low this year because I’m struggling. Today is September 1st and I just got back from my first ride. I managed to ride six miles. I’ll try to add mileage each day but I don’t know if I will be able. I’ll give it my best shot.
